Alive After 5 Begins Tonight

Alive After 5, an event that brings crowds to historic Roswell, kicks off the season tonight from 5 to 9 p.m.

Alive After 5 kicks off for the season tonight, Thursday, April 19, in historic Roswell. There will be activities on Canton Street – including outdoor vendors, balloons, four live bands and a free trolley that will drop people off at different locations. Many retailers and art galleries also stay open late.

The event, in its seventh year, draws crowds to Roswell’s historic district and runs every third Thursday through October. Tonight’s event is from 5 to 9 pm.

Various business and community organizations will also be distributing information and giveaways. Roswell's Relay for Life will have "Plum Fun For Relay" in the Plum Tree Village area. They are offering various things for sale, including: car raffle tickets, Relay for Life luminaries, drinks, cookies, face painting, tie-dyed shirts, pizza and lemonade. There will also be an inflatable jumpy house for kids.
